Baptist MD Anderson Cancer Center is set to launch a new cellular therapy and stem cell program, aiming to enhance treatment options for patients battling various types of cancer. This initiative will focus on innovative therapies, including CAR T-cell therapy, which involves modifying a patient’s own immune cells to better target and destroy cancer cells. The program represents a significant advancement in the center’s commitment to providing cutting-edge care and improving patient outcomes. By integrating these advanced therapies into their offerings, Baptist MD Anderson aims to position itself at the forefront of cancer treatment, potentially increasing survival rates and reducing the burden of cancer for patients in the community.

The establishment of this program is particularly timely, given the growing recognition of the effectiveness of cellular therapies in treating hematologic malignancies, such as leukemia and lymphoma. With this initiative, Baptist MD Anderson will also focus on developing protocols for the safe administration of stem cell transplants, thereby expanding treatment possibilities for patients with solid tumors as well. By leveraging the expertise of their multidisciplinary team, the center hopes to not only provide individualized treatment plans but also contribute to the broader field of cancer research and therapy development.
